
Physician (Public Health)
The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services is seeking a motivated and experienced Physician (Public Health) to join our team. The successful candidate will be a dynamic leader with a commitment to providing superior public health services and a passion for improving the overall health of our nation. The ideal candidate will have a Doctor of Medicine (MD) degree, board-certified in a specialty recognized by the American Board of Medical Specialties or the Bureau of Osteopathic Specialists, and a minimum of two years of experience in public health, preventive medicine, or clinical medicine. We are looking for a professional who has excellent communication and organizational skills along with the ability to work independently and collaboratively. The successful candidate must also have a proven record of applying public health principles in practice and a strong understanding of current public health regulations. We are excited to bring someone on board who is driven and passionate about public health and can help us to continue providing the highest level of public health services for the American people.
Responsibilities:
- Provide high quality public health services to the American people.
- Develop and implement public health programs to improve the health of our nation.
- Monitor and evaluate public health programs to ensure they are meeting their goals.
- Collaborate with other healthcare professionals and stakeholders to ensure effective public health programs.
- Advocate for public health initiatives at the local, state, and federal level.
- Stay up to date on current public health regulations and ensure compliance with all regulations.
- Provide education and training to public health practitioners and the public.
- Develop research and policy initiatives to improve public health outcomes.
- Develop and implement strategies to promote health awareness and education among the public.
- Utilize data and analytics to identify public health trends and inform policy decisions.

The United States Department of Health & Human Services, also known as the Health Department, is a cabinet-level department of the U.S. federal government with the goal of protecting the health of all Americans and providing essential human services.
